Who is Sahlah Academy

Sahlah Academy (SDN BHD) was incorporated in April 2019 in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ia by AbdelKader Amor and Mohamed Saifudin Bin Mohamed Ariff with the purpose of providing foreign language instruction, training, and professional and pre-professional services and courses to the public both in and outside of Malaysia. With locations onsite in Indonesia, Malaysia, and Turkiye, as well as an online academy servicing student around the world, Sahlah Academy seeks to provide accredited educational services to students worldwide, with a focus on underprivileged, migrant, and refugee populations.
